Public Finance:
Summary: “Public Finance” provides a comprehensive overview of the principles and practices of public finance, covering topics such as government revenue, expenditure, taxation, and fiscal policy. This textbook explores the role of government in economic activities, the impact of public policies on the economy, and the various tools and techniques used in public finance management. With a focus on both theoretical concepts and real-world applications, the book serves as an essential resource for students, policymakers, and practitioners interested in understanding the dynamics of public finance.
Author: Harvey S. Rosen is the author of this book.
